The UNRWA volunteer program in Gaza aims to provide new graduates with a structured opportunity to gain working experience within their specializations. UNRWA volunteers are coached by their supervisors, obtain training and apply their skills in a work setting.

Please note (!) to register and apply you will need to meet the following requirements:

  • You are between 19-26 years old
  • You are a Palestine Refugee registered with UNRWA
  • You are a graduate that graduated before June 2019
  • You are living in the Gaza Strip
  • You graduated from a recognized insitution in Gaza OR from an international or West Bank institution.
  • You have not previously worked or volunteerd for UNRWA (except if you have worked as an unskilled JCP then you may apply)

Volunteering for UNRWA is a learning opportunity for you to gain work experience related to your specialization and develop your skills. It is not an employemnt and there can be no expectation of getting an employment with UNRWA upon finishing the volunteering period.

Before applying to become a volunteer it is important that you are aware and read the following conditions that apply to all UNRWA volunteers in Gaza.

  • Volunteers are unpaid and do not receivie any type of compensation.
  • Medical insurance is the responsbility of the voluntee). Volunteers are not covered by UNRWA medical insurance or other insurances.
  • Transport to and from your duty station are as a general rule not provided. Some exceptions can be made when space is available on UNRWA staff buses. To minimize transportation needs we will try and place volunteers as close as possible to where they live.
  • The volunteering period is 6 months.
  • Volunteers will be issued with an Experience Certificate after finishing the volunteering period.
  • Volunteers will have access to UNRWA e-learning.

We encourage persons with disabilities to apply for volunteering positions. Please note that not all UNRWA installations are adapted for persons with physical disability. It is specified in each job description which duty stations are adapted for persons with physical disability.Please, be reminded that transport to and from the duty station is not provided by UNRWA.
